A beautifully restored piece of British design history, this original World War Two CC41 half moon table has been refinished by That Flipping Studio.
Dating from the 1940s, CC41 furniture was produced under the government’s Utility Furniture Scheme, created to provide well-made, functional pieces during wartime austerity. Simple, honest design and quality craftsmanship defines these tables - and this one is no exception.
